Filled with the sunshiny flavor of pineapple juice and effervescence from a healthy splash of mineral water, my Pineapple Tequila Spritzer is as much a thirst-quencher as it is a happy hour hero. Made with just 4 ingredients in less than 5 minutes, this tropically-inspired tequila pineapple cocktail will quickly reset your internal clock to Island Time.
Add mezcal or tequila, lemon juice, pineapple juice to a cocktail shaker filled with ice and shake for about 30 seconds.
Strain into a glass over large ice cubes and top with mineral water. Garnish with a pineapple leaf, if desired.

Expert Tips:
Shake it like you mean it. If you're someone who has ever wondered why professional bartenders seem to make such a show out of shaking their drinks, you're not alone. That said, it's for more than just show! Shaking a cocktail helps to aerate the drink with small shards of ice, which serves to both chill it and give it a lovely mouthfeel.
